双氯芬酸的长时间超声透入疗法可增强常见肌肉骨骼损伤的康复效果。

Long Duration Sonophoresis of Diclofenac to Augment Rehabilitation of Common Musculoskeletal Injuries.

作者信息

Jarit Paddy, Klyve Dominic, Walters Rod

机构信息

Department of Sport & Orthopaedic Physical Therapy, Fairfield, CT, USA.

Department of Mathematics, Central Washington University, Ellensburg, WI, USA.

出版信息

Glob J Orthop Res. 2023;4(2). Epub 2023 Jan 20.

PMID:36865667
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C9977165/
Abstract

BACKGROUND

The use of long duration sonophoresis (LDS) for musculoskeletal injuries is a new and emerging treatment option for patients undergoing rehabilitation. The treatment is non-invasive, provides multi-hour mechanical stimulus expediating tissue regeneration and deep tissue heat along with local application of therapeutic compound for improved pain relief. The objective of this prospective case study was to evaluate real-world application of diclofenac LDS as an add-on intervention for patients non-responsive to physical therapy alone.

METHODS

Patient who failed to respond to at least 4 weeks of physical therapy were treated with the addition of 2.5% diclofenac LDS daily for 4 weeks. The numerical rating scale, global health improvement score, functional improvement, and treatment satisfaction index were measured to assess pain reduction and quality of life improvement from treatment. Patient outcome data was organized by injury type and patient age groups, and statistically analyzed with ANOVA to assess treatment differences within and between groups. The study was registered on clinicaltrails.gov NCT05254470.

RESULT

The study included (n=135) musculoskeletal injury LDS treatments with no adverse events. Patients reported a mean pain reduction from baseline of 4.44 points (p<0.0001) and a 4.85point health improvement score after 4-week of daily sonophoresis treatment. There were no age-related differences in pain reduction, and 97.8% of patients in the study reported functional improvement with the addition of LDS treatment. Significant pain relief was observed in injuries related to tendinopathy, sprain, strain, contusion, bone fracture, and post-surgical recovery.

CONCLUSION

The use of LDS significantly reduced pain and improved musculoskeletal function and quality of life for patients. Clinical findings suggest that LDS with 2.5% diclofenac is a viable therapeutic option for practitioners and should be further investigated.

摘要

背景

对于正在接受康复治疗的患者,长时间超声透入疗法(LDS)用于肌肉骨骼损伤是一种新出现的治疗选择。该治疗是非侵入性的,能提供数小时的机械刺激以加速组织再生和深部组织加热,同时局部应用治疗性化合物以更好地缓解疼痛。本前瞻性病例研究的目的是评估双氯芬酸LDS作为单独物理治疗无反应患者的附加干预措施在实际中的应用。

方法

对至少4周物理治疗无反应的患者,每日加用2.5%双氯芬酸LDS治疗4周。采用数字评分量表、整体健康改善评分、功能改善和治疗满意度指数来评估治疗后疼痛减轻情况和生活质量改善情况。患者结局数据按损伤类型和患者年龄组进行整理,并采用方差分析进行统计学分析,以评估组内和组间的治疗差异。该研究已在clinicaltrails.gov上注册,注册号为NCT05254470。

结果

该研究包括135例肌肉骨骼损伤的LDS治疗,无不良事件发生。患者报告每日超声透入治疗4周后平均疼痛较基线减轻4.44分(p<0.0001),健康改善评分为4.85分。疼痛减轻方面无年龄相关差异,研究中97.8%的患者报告加用LDS治疗后功能改善。在与肌腱病、扭伤、拉伤、挫伤、骨折和术后恢复相关的损伤中观察到显著的疼痛缓解。

结论

LDS的使用显著减轻了患者的疼痛,改善了肌肉骨骼功能和生活质量。临床研究结果表明,2.5%双氯芬酸的LDS对从业者来说是一种可行的治疗选择,应进一步研究。
